Casey Dahlin (cjdahlin at ncsu.edu) said: 
>> How are you handling $time, $localfs, $named, etc?
>
> At the moment they are just like any other provides, so they would be 
> handled by a script (which will presumably just report on the status of the 
> given item). This will likely change, however.

Right, that's the tricky part. $localfs leads to 'fun' loops when it's
handled as part of the script, since it needs to be added at the latest
possible point (after $network_fs, therefore in netfs). This then leads
to loops. Similarly, $named needs to be provided by named, if it's started.
Otherwise it needs to be provided by $network. Or possibly openldap, if
you're using nss_ldap in your nsswitch.conf.
